You can buy a used wood burners near me stove in the UK. However you must be cautious where and how you purchase it. If you buy an appliance that isn't compliance with current regulations, you could end up breaking the law. Ecodesign was designed to increase wood burning stove for shed burning stoves' efficiency and reduce their carbon emissions. However, if a stove is manufactured and placed on the market before January 2022, it may be sold as secondhand and not meet the Ecodesign requirements.
Another aspect to consider is the longevity of an older stove. Older stoves are less sophisticated features, which could lead to issues in the future. For instance, a second-hand wood burner may have an old door made of cast iron which could break or crack as time passes. Seals can also become loose and second hand wood burner affect the effectiveness of the stove.

Maintenance
Wood burners are becoming more popular and can be an addition to any home. They are beautiful and energy efficient, and they are often used to create a relaxing ambience. Like any other furniture piece, fireplaces and stoves require regular maintenance. Simple maintenance can help prevent problems and extend the lifespan of your wood burning stove.
The right kind of log burner for your home is vital. Take into consideration the size of your home and how much heat it's required to produce. There are a myriad of types of wood-burning stoves including gas, electric and cast iron models. It is also important to be aware of the aesthetics of your space and your personal style preferences.
It is essential to check the condition and quality when buying an used stove. Certain older stoves will require to be completely rebuilt, which can cost a lot. This is especially applicable to stoves that are over 30 years old.
Cleaning your wood stove frequently is the first step to maintaining it. The ash drawer should be emptied and the baffle plate checked for soot accumulations. Keeping your stove clean will enhance its performance and protect against carbon monoxide poisoning.
Another important aspect to maintain a wood-burning stove is to make sure that the gaskets and seals are in good operating condition. These components maintain an encapsulated seal that prevents the entry of harmful fumes and smoke into your home. They should be checked on a regular basis and any that are damaged or worn should be replaced as soon as possible.
In addition to cleaning your stove It is also important to check the chimney liner and stove for signs of wear and tear. It is recommended to contact an expert if you see any cracks, gaps, or other damage. Moreover, you should always use clean wood and ensure that your stove is ventilated to avoid the build-up of carbon monoxide gas within your home.
